What the ordinance says

The four nuisance categories that touch food waste.

Verbatim excerpts from Rapid City Municipal Code 8.16.010. Read the full chapter for the complete enumeration.

8.16.010(C) — Compost piles

Onsite compost piles that smell, harbor disease, or attract pests

Any compost pile which is of such a nature as to spread or harbor disease, emit unpleasant odors or harmful gas, or attract rodents, vermin or other disease carrying pests, animals or insects…

8.16.010(C) — Food odors

Vegetable matter and food waste that emit offensive odors

All vegetables, vegetable matters, or other articles that emit or cause an offensive, noxious or disagreeable smell or odor…

8.16.010(C) — Grease & fats

Oil, grease, fat, or hazardous material not properly contained and covered

Any oil, grease, fat, or hazardous material, that is not properly contained and covered… Any ground area… that has been covered by or otherwise negatively impacted by oil, grease, fat, or a hazardous material…

8.16.010(C) — Visible waste

Waste stored, collected, or piled in view of adjacent properties or the public right-of-way

…items… stored, collected, piled or kept on private or public property, and in view of adjacent properties or public right-of-ways.

Under RCMC 8.16.035, a first notice gives you 7 calendar days to remedy or abate the nuisance (3 days for a repeat in the same calendar year). If the city has to abate for you, the cost — plus administrative fees — can be special-assessed against the property.
